Subject: [PATCH next] media: rockchip: rkcif: fix off by one bugs
Date: Wed, 19 Nov 2025 11:09:54 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<aR17UkYsfAxCZ4fe@stanley.mountain> (raw)

Change these comparisons from > vs >= to avoid accessing one element
beyond the end of the arrays.

Fixes: 1f2353f5a1af ("media: rockchip: rkcif: add support for rk3568 vicap mipi capture")
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@linaro.org>
---
 .../media/platform/rockchip/rkcif/rkcif-capture-mipi.c | 10 +++++-----
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kcif/rkcif-capture-mipi.c b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kcif/rkcif-capture-mipi.c
index 1b81bcc067ef..a933df682acc 100644
--- a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kcif/rkcif-capture-mipi.c
+++ b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kcif/rkcif-capture-mipi.c
@@ -489,8 +489,8 @@ static inline unsigned int rkcif_mipi_get_reg(struct rkcif_interface *interface,
 
 	block = interface->index -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E;
 
-	if (WARN_ON_ONCE(block > RKCIF_MIPI_MAX -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E) ||
-	    WARN_ON_ONCE(index > RKCIF_MIPI_REGISTER_MAX))
+	if (WARN_ON_ONCE(block >= RKCIF_MIPI_MAX -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E) ||
+	    WARN_ON_ONCE(index >= RKCIF_MIPI_REGISTER_MAX))
 		return RKCIF_REGISTER_NOTSUPPORTED;
 
 	offset = rkcif->match_data->mipi->blocks[block].offset;
@@ -510,9 +510,9 @@ static inline unsigned int rkcif_mipi_id_get_reg(struct rkcif_stream *stream,
 	block = stream->interface->index -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E;
 	id = stream->id;
 
-	if (WARN_ON_ONCE(block > RKCIF_MIPI_MAX -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E) ||
-	    WARN_ON_ONCE(id > RKCIF_ID_MAX) ||
-	    WARN_ON_ONCE(index > RKCIF_MIPI_ID_REGISTER_MAX))
+	if (WARN_ON_ONCE(block >= RKCIF_MIPI_MAX - RKCIF_MIPI_BASE) ||
+	    WARN_ON_ONCE(id >= RKCIF_ID_MAX) ||
+	    WARN_ON_ONCE(index >= RKCIF_MIPI_ID_REGISTER_MAX))
 		return RKCIF_REGISTER_NOTSUPPORTED;
 
 	offset = rkcif->match_data->mipi->blocks[block].offset;
